👋 Madalyn again! As long as the weather keeps calling for soup, I'm answering — this time with Kung Fu Noodle.
The vibe: This relaxed Chinese soup spot near USAA was new to me, but judging by the crowd, I'm late to the party.
What to try: The beef noodle soup ($11.28). It's perfectly slurpable, the beef is fall-apart tender and the broth is full-bodied in flavor.
The bottom line: It's fast, unfussy and exactly the kind of comfort food chilly days call for.
